What is a “DHI Hair Transplant”? An In-Depth Explanation
DHI, which stands for Direct Hair Implantation, is a state-of-the-art hair transplant technique that revolutionizes traditional methods. Unlike the conventional Follicular Unit Transplantation (FUT) or Follicular Unit Extraction (FUE), “DHI hair transplant” involves the direct implantation of hair follicles into thinning or bald areas using a specialized device called the DHI implanter or Choi Pen. This allows for more precise, controlled, and minimally invasive implantation, leading to superior aesthetic results.
In essence, the “DHI hair transplant” process combines follicle harvesting and implantation into a single step, significantly reducing the time between extraction and implantation. This method preserves the vitality and survival rate of hair follicles, making it highly effective for natural and dense hair coverage.

Step-by-Step Overview of the “DHI Hair Transplant” Procedure
The process of “DHI hair transplant” is meticulously planned and executed to ensure optimal density and a natural appearance. It generally involves the following stages:
1. Consultation & Assessment
Professionals thoroughly evaluate the patient's scalp, degree of hair loss, donor area quality, and medical history. Custom treatment plans are crafted to meet individual goals.
2. Hair Follicle Extraction
Local anesthesia is applied to minimize discomfort. Folllicles are then carefully extracted from the donor area—typically the back or sides of the scalp—using specialized micro-punch tools. These follicles are preserved in a nutrient-rich solution to maintain vitality.
3. Preparation of Recipient Area
While the follicles are harvested, the surgeon designs the recipient area, marking hairline borders and bald zones to ensure symmetry and natural aesthetics.
4. Direct Implantation Using DHI Implanter
The harvested follicles are immediately implanted into the prepared bald or thinning areas using the DHI implanter. This device allows for controlled insertion at specific angles, depths, and densities personalized for each patient's hair growth pattern.
5. Post-Procedure Care & Recovery
Following the procedure, patients receive detailed aftercare instructions. Mild swelling, crusting, or redness may occur but typically resolve within a few days. Most patients return to work within a couple of days, with full results observable over the next 6-12 months.

The Cost of DHI Hair Transplant: What to Expect?
The cost of a “DHI hair transplant” varies based on multiple factors, including the extent of hair loss, the number of grafts needed, the clinic’s reputation, and geographic location. Generally, the price per graft ranges from $3 to $7, but this can fluctuate.

Post-Procedure Care and Achieving Optimal Results
Success in “DHI hair transplant” depends heavily on adherence to postoperative instructions. Key guidelines include:
- Keeping the scalp clean and avoiding vigorous washing during initial days.
- Avoiding strenuous physical activity for at least a week.
- Refraining from scratching or disturbing the transplanted area.
- Applying prescribed medications and topical solutions to promote healing.
- Attending follow-up appointments for monitoring progress and addressing concerns.
Patience is critical—full results typically develop over 6 to 12 months, with hair gradually thickening and blending seamlessly with natural hair.
